Presider:  

As followers of the suffering servant, we pray humbly for ourselves, for one another, and for our brothers and sisters throughout the world.

Lector:

  • For the Church, that she may continue to model servant leadership, following Christ’s example of humility and self-sacrifice, we pray to the Lord:
  • For world leaders, that they may work to promote peace, justice, and the well-being of all people, putting aside personal gain for the common good, we pray to the Lord:
  • For a deeper trust in God’s plan for our lives, that we may seek His wisdom and strength in times of difficulty, we pray to the Lord:
  • For our parish community, that we may embody Christ’s call to serve others with humility and generosity, especially through our support of those in need, we pray to the Lord:
